Same thing here. Ordered the two strips and got the whole kit. Took a little digging but got the strips and plugs fully working.
- Install the two device handlers from this thread (parent and child DTH)
- Install the DTH for the single outlet plugs that I linked at the bottom of this post
- Plug in one of the devices (strip or single plug)
- Press and hold the small white sync button for a few seconds until the lights start rotating
- If lights are rotating clockwise, use the ST app to add the device.
If lights are rotating counter-clockwise, it’s in exclusion mode. See my notes at the bottom for that.
The strips should automatically add all 6 outlets plus 1 device for the whole strip.
The plugs will be detected as “Z-Wave Relay” and need to be changed in the ST IDE
- Go to the IDE → My Devices
- Click on the plug (eg. “Z-Wave Relay”)
- Click edit at the bottom of the page
- Change “Type” to “GreenWave PowerNode (Single) Advanced” to use the DTH I linked at the bottom
Exclusion (counter-clockwise lights)
- Plug in the gateway that came in the box (shouldn’t need network)
- Wait a minute for it to power up
- Press and hold the green sync button on the gateway until the lights rotate counter-clockwise like they do on the strip/plug
- When both the strip/plug are in exclusion mode, it should just take a second before the light stops rotating which means it’s been excluded from the hub
- Now you can press and hold the sync button on the strip/plug again and it should go clockwise and be ready to add to ST.
